Doll Poem by Aram Stefanian

Doll

Rating: 1.5


You look like an aging doll
Time is ruthless and hurting
Your pretty boobs are sagging
But you seem not ot care at all

Over your impaired vision you see red
Your retentive memory fails
You can't remember your boyfriends' names
A thick layer of French makeup

Can't hide neither wrinkles
Nor bags under your eyes
Your cheeks are sunken
And chin is doubled

With your quiet neighbors
You start quarrels
Though down inside you still
Feel like a cute little girl

Your libido is growing
With each passing day
You are still looking for hot studs
To pick up and lay

The only thing you're scared of
Is going alone to bed
